What is Thymalin?
Thymalin is a thymus-derived peptide bioregulator originally developed in the Soviet Union to address immune decline and age-related dysfunction at its root. Extracted from thymus tissue, it contains a complex of bioactive peptides that act directly on the body’s immune control center—helping regulate and restore T-cell production, which naturally declines with age. Unlike conventional immune boosters, Thymalin doesn’t overstimulate - it works at a deeper level, helping recalibrate immune function toward a more balanced, youthful state.
What makes Thymalin unique?
What makes Thymalin unique is its gene-regulatory mechanism. Research shows these short peptides interact with DNA and chromatin structures to influence gene expression in immune cells - supporting T-lymphocyte differentiation, cytokine balance, and cellular longevity. Clinical studies spanning decades have linked Thymalin to improved immune markers, reduced infection rates, and even significant reductions in mortality among aging populations, positioning it as one of the most extensively studied peptide bioregulators in longevity science.
